Engineer I - iSeries Power Systems
Position OverviewThe primary responsibility of the iSeries / Power Systems role is to install and manage hardware and software, troubleshoot, and support IBM iSeries and Power Systems that support business applications. All duties are to be performed in accordance with departmental policies, practices, and procedures.Essential Duties & ResponsibilitiesAdminister, maintain, and support iSeries / Power Systems hardware and software.Anticipate, identify, mitigate, troubleshoot, and resolve hardware and software issues. Escalate incidents as necessary.Manage incoming service requests and incidents through the Help Desk ticketing system related to iSeries / Power Systems activities.Collaborate with vendors, peers, and contractors to ensure secure and reliable system implementations and upgrades within project parameters.Monitor iSeries / Power Systems file systems, shares, and permissions.Monitor system performance and provide performance statistics and reporting.
